### Step 4: Enable the Larkspindle tile cache

This step introduces the cache layer between the renderer and tile requests. Reviewers should confirm that eviction is LRU, that stale tiles are served only during upstream outages, and that the warm-up job targets zoom levels 0–8. Verify the submitted defaults against this reference configuration:

service settings:
[casax]
port = 6379
team = rusir
host = casax.zemvarhq.corp
region = outer-4
access_code = ac_9808ce
timeout_ms = 1500

## Runbook: Migrating off the Grindle ORM

Welcome! When refactoring a legacy model, run the shadow-write comparator first — it diffs old Grindle queries against the new Fernwood data layer and flags drift. Don't skip it; we've been burned twice. The comparator needs access to the Fernwood staging API, and your default contractor token won't work there. Use the dedicated service key below.

app token of bahaf-tajeg = zpat23_SjjsllwiLmXbtS65veZaV47

Subject: Runbook notes — Greenmantle donation-receipt mailer

Hi team,

A few details for whoever is on call this week. The receipt mailer for the Greenmantle giving platform batches every fifteen minutes; each batch pulls confirmed donations, renders the PDF receipt, and hands off to the Swiftpost relay. If the relay returns a 5xx, the batch requeues once before paging. Do not manually re-run a batch while a requeue is pending — you'll double-send receipts.

To inspect queue state, call the admin endpoint with the bearer token below.

session JWT of yawep-yawep = eyJhbGciOiJIUzI1NiIsInR5cCI6IkpXVCJ9.eyJzdWIiOiI3pWF3_In0.aXYsHiog